FNU mode
Range
0.00 to 9.99; 10.0 to 99.9; 100 to 1000 FNU
Resolution
0.01; 0.1; 1 FNU
Accuracy
±2% of reading plus straylight
FAU mode
Range
10.0 to 99.9; 100 to 4000 FAU
Resolution
0.1; 1 FAU
Accuracy
±10% of reading
NTU ratio mode
Range
0.00 to 9.99; 10.0 to 99.9; 100 to 4000 NTU
0.00 to 9.99; 10.0 to 99.9; 100 to 980 EBC
Resolution
0.01; 0.1; 1 NTU
0.01; 0.1; 1 EBC
Accuracy
±2% of reading plus straylight
±5% of reading above 1000 NTU
NTU non ratio mode
Range
0.00 to 9.99; 10.0 to 99.9; 100 to 1000 NTU
0.00 to 9.99; 10.0 to 99.9; 100 to 245 EBC
Resolution
0.01; 0.1; 1 NTU
0.01; 0.1; 1 EBC
Accuracy
±2% of reading plus straylight
Range selection
Automatic
Repeatibility
±1% of reading or straylight, whichever is greater
Stray Light
< 0.1 NTU (0.05 EBC)
Light Detector
Silicon Photocell
Method
ISO 7027 Method
Measuring mode
Normal, Average, Continuous.
Turbidity Standards
<0.1, 15, 100, 750 FNU and 2000 NTU
Calibration
Two, three, four or five-point calibration
Light Source
IR LED
Lamp life
Instrument life
Display
40 x 70mm graphic LCD (64x128 pixels) with backlight
LOG Memory
200 records
Serial Interface
USB
Environment
0°C (32°F) to 50°C (122°F); max 95% RH non-condensing
Power supply
12 Vdc power input
Dimensions
230 x 200 x 145 mm (9 x 7.9 x 5.7”) L x W x H
Weight
2.5 Kg (88 oz.)
